Essential Ingredients for Boursin Chicken
Gathering the right ingredients is key to nailing this Boursin chicken recipe. Each one plays a role in creating that creamy, flavorful dish you can’t wait to try. Below, I’ll list out everything you need, including precise measurements and a quick explanation of why they’re important.
Main Ingredients
- 2 large chicken breasts – These form the base of the Boursin chicken, providing lean protein that’s easy to cook and absorb flavors.
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der – Adds a punchy garlic note without overwhelming the dish, enhancing the overall herb profile in your Boursin chicken recipe.
- Salt and pepper to taste – Basic seasonings that bring out the natural flavors of the chicken and balance the creamy sauce in this easy Boursin chicken.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il – Used for searing the chicken, it helps achieve a golden crust while keeping things moist and flavorful.
- 1 tablespoon butter – Adds richness to the pan and aids in browning the chicken for a more delicious Boursin chicken with garlic and herbs.
- 1/2 medium onion, chopped – Provides a subtle sweetness and depth to the sauce, making this creamy garlic Boursin chicken even more aromatic.
- 3/4 cup chicken broth (low sodium can be used) – Creates the base of the sauce, with the option for low-sodium versions to control salt levels.
- 1 (5.2 oz) package herb and garlic soft cheese, softened – The star ingredient that melts into a creamy sauce, defining the taste of this Boursin cheese chicken.
- 1-2 tablespoons chopped parsley, optional – A fresh touch that brightens the dish, though it’s great for those who want to add a bit of color and flavor to their Boursin chicken.

How to Prepare the Perfect Boursin Chicken: Step-by-Step Guide
Ready to dive into making this Boursin chicken? It’s simpler than it sounds, and I’ll walk you through each step to ensure your creamy garlic Boursin chicken turns out amazing. With about 30 minutes from start to finish, this one-pan Boursin chicken is perfect for weeknights. Let’s get started with the basics of preparation.
First Step: Prepare the Chicken
Begin by cutting 2 large chicken breasts in half lengthwise to create four thinner pieces. This helps them cook evenly and quickly in your Boursin chicken recipe. Season the pieces with 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der, salt, and pepper to taste, ensuring every bit is covered for maximum flavor.
Second Step: Cook the Chicken
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il and 1 tablespoon butter in a skillet over medium-high heat. Once the pan is hot, add the seasoned chicken and cook for about 5-6 minutes per side until it’s golden brown and cooked through. For safety, use a meat thermometer to check that it reaches 165°F.Transfer the chicken to a plate and set it aside, letting the flavors from your Boursin chicken develop.
Third Step: Sauté the Onions
In the same skillet, add 1/2 medium onion, chopped, and sauté for about 5 minutes or until it’s softened and lightly browned. If the pan looks dry, add a bit more olive oil to keep things moving. This step builds the base flavor for your creamy garlic Boursin chicken, adding a nice depth that complements the herbs.
Fourth Step: Make the Sauce
Pour in 3/4 cup chicken broth and add the 1 (5.2 oz) package of softened herb and garlic soft cheese. Stir everything together until the sauce is smooth and creamy. Let it simmer for about 5 minutes to thicken, creating that signature sauce for your easy Boursin chicken. If you’re adapting for dietary needs, this is a great point to swap in low-sodium broth.
Fifth Step: Add Finishing Touches
Stir in 1-2 tablespoons of chopped parsley if you’re using it, for a fresh pop of green. Return the cooked chicken and any juices to the skillet, warming everything through for a couple of minutes. Final Step: Serve and Enjoy
Once everything is heated and the sauce is just right, serve your Boursin chicken immediately. This simple Boursin chicken breast dish pairs well with sides like rice or veggies. Total time is about 30 minutes, with 10 minutes prep and 20 minutes cooking, yielding 4 servings. How to Store Boursin Chicken: Best Practices
Proper storage keeps your Boursin chicken tasting fresh. For refrigeration, store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for 3-4 days to maintain quality. Freezing isn’t recommended as it can affect the texture, but if you must, do so in portions for up to a month. When reheating, use low heat on the stove to preserve the creamy sauce, adding a splash of broth if needed.
